Summary

A vulnerability has been identified in the Tenda i29 router version 1.0.0.5 that allows for a buffer overflow via the time parameter in the sysLogin function. This flaw could potentially allow an attacker to execute arbitrary code, leading to unauthorized access and system compromise. Users are advised to apply appropriate security measures to mitigate the risks associated with this vulnerability.
